Consider the following statements: 1. Coal ash contains arsenic, lead and mercury. 2. Coal-fired power plants release sulphur dioxide and oxides of nitrogen into the environment. 3. High ash content is observed in Indian coal. Which of the statements given above is/are correct?
A.1, 2 and 3✓ Correct
B.3 only
C.2 and 3 only
D.1 only
Explanation
Coal ash contains toxic heavy metals like arsenic, lead and mercury; coal combustion releases SO2 and NOx; and Indian coal is notably high in ash content (35-45%). All three statements are correct.
